Transaction 882c8f4a5fa82ff6ef1dc847668ce4d6872e84f3c7c6281e567214106ec71734

3 Input
1 Outputs
  • 882c8f4a5fa82ff6ef1dc847668ce4d6872e84f3c7c6281e567214106ec71734:0
  • value  2906846
    address  35fjQZ9V4KHYqE62nUMDchNUBfbTxUustK